Stimulants
Stimulants increase the speed of the body's systems including the nervous system. They are prescribed medications that treat narcolepsy, obesity and att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). They are also abused illegally as recreational drugs to increase energy and concentration. They can be injected, snorted, or taken orally. Under the Controlled Substances Act (CSA) stimulants are classified as Schedule II drugs, which implies they pose a substantial risk of abuse.
Amphetamines, in conjunction with the methylphenidate are two of the most commonly used stimulant drugs. Amphetamines improve alertness, focus and productivity by increasing the levels of chemical in your brain that are called dopamine and norepinephrine. They can help those with ADHD feel less tired and improve their concentration. They can also help people who suffer from adult adhd treatments sleep better and reduce depression. They can also help reduce risky behaviors, such as gambling, drinking and a drug addiction.
These medications can cause serious side effects if taken improperly or excessively. These medications should be taken as directed by your physician.
People who abuse stimulants may develop a dependence and develop an addiction, called stimulant use disorder. It is essential to identify symptoms of this disorder and seek treatment. The signs include a need for the medication, difficulties stopping the use, and negative impact on your daily life and relationships.
Stimulants aren't only addictive, but they can also be dangerous for those with certain health conditions. These drugs can raise your heart rate and blood pressure which could lead to a heart attack or [empty] stroke. They may also cause seizures, as well as other mental problems.
Many people who suffer from ADHD notice a positive change in their symptoms within a few weeks after starting stimulant medication. However, it can take longer for some people to see improvements. Most people notice the improvements in their friends, family members or colleagues, as well as teachers.
Addiction to stimulants may occur when people consume them in higher doses or for longer periods than prescribed by their medical professionals. It may also occur when stimulants are combined with other substances, such as opioids. This could result in a dangerous combination of effects that increases the chance of an overdose or death.
These stimulants can cause dependence, but they are less likely to lead to addiction than illicit drugs like methamphetamines and cocaine. However any substance used incorrectly can lead to dependence and addiction.
